Question-and-Answer Session

[Operator Instructions]. Your first question comes from Lisa Gill with JPMorgan.

Lisa Gill - JPMorgan

Thank you, and good morning. I just have a couple of quick questions, Joel. First off, when we think about specialty pharmacy and the recent acquisition that you made and your continued growth in specialty pharmacy, can you just give us an idea of how many of your beds today utilize specialty pharmacy? Is it just that the number that you disclose or are those beds on top of current beds that you have for regular medication that you are serving, just so I understand that? And then secondly on the Full Potential Plan, when you talked about the benefits now going beyond 2009, should we still be looking at the benefit next year still being in that $100 million to $120 million range?

Joel F. Gemunder - President and Chief Executive Officer

Your first question was to what extend do we use biologic agents in our base business, if I understood the question correctly, and the answer is, it's a growing portion of our routine business in the institutional pharmacy setting, because the... of the new drugs being produced, the vast majority of these drugs that are being approved by the FDA are for treatments hitherto unavailable to patients, and many of these new treatments are in the form of large molecule or biologic... essentially proteins. And we're seeing that move is by no means the majority of our business today, but it is a growing robust element of our business because these diseases that these drugs are meant to deal with are largely found in the elderly population.

Lisa Gill - JPMorgan

Okay, and when we think about that opportunity, just in general terms, are the margins generally better around the specialty pharmacy than it is for your core book of business?

Joel F. Gemunder - President and Chief Executive Officer

I'd say it comprise of wide range, some are better, some are not as good as some other drugs. Remember there is a patented products and the pharmaceutical manufacturer really controls the margin in this business. So I would say, on average it's probably a little bit higher than our normal margin that's growing.
